Mysql jdbc connection hibernate download

The default port number for an ordinary mysql connection is 3306, and it is 33060 for a connection using the x protocol. In your case, you need to add the jdbc library to your project manually. Establishing a connection the java tutorials jdbctm. In this tutorial, you will learn how to query data from a table in the postgresql database using the jdbc api. It provides a set of java api for accessing the relational databases from java program. Having mariadb and mysql drivers in the same classpath. Download mysqlconnectorjava jar file with dependencies documentation source code all downloads are free. In addition, a native c library allows developers to embed mysql directly into their applications. In general, applicationspecific jars such as hibernates connection pooling jars should not be placed in the lib directory of tomcat. Dec 05, 2007 accessing mysql on netbeans using jdbc, part 1. Java hibernate cannot connect to mysql database stack. In this previous tutorial, we have seen how to insert one or multiple rows into the postgresql database using the jdbc api. Mariadb connectorj provides 2 different datasource pool implementations.

To connect java application with the mysql database, we need to follow 5 following steps. And mysql database server has a timeout value for each connection default is 8 hours or 28,800 seconds. To permit having mariadb connectorj and mysqls jdbc driver in your classpath at the same time, mariadb connectorj. Then goto services tab, right click on database, click on new connection, select driver mysql connector j driver, next, enter username and password of mysql database which you created. Another way to get a connection with mariadb connectorj is to use a connection pool. Download mysqlconnectorjava jar file with all dependencies. Download and extract the mysql jdbc connector, from this link. Once you have selected the mysql jdbc driver, switch to the jar list tab.

Mysql provides standardsbased drivers for jdbc, odbc, and. Using hibernate in a web application apache netbeans. Hello, what settings do i need in a hibernate spring configuration file xml for mariadb. These drivers are developed and maintained by the mysql community. In this example, we will write jdbc code separate from the jsp page. Connecting to mysql using the jdbc drivermanager interface. After installing the plugin, start the mysql database by expanding the databases node in the services window, rightclicking the mysql server node and choosing start. The file is located in the under the source packages node in the projects window. Mariadb connectorj permits connection urls beginning with both jdbc. Jdbc driver the mysql connector can be downloaded here and added to your project build path. When connecting to mysql, anything could happens e. To do this, copy the mysql connectorj jar file to the domaindirlib directory.

Follow step 3 without maven in this article 1 where you need to add the mysql libraries. Glassfish can be downloaded from the glassfish website. Tomcat, hibernate, and database connection pooling. Building highperformance web applications in mysql 2006 by guy harrison, steven feuerstein mysql crash course 2005 by ben forta a guide to mysql available titles skills assessment manager sam. Perform sql operations this tutorial show you how to use netbeans to connect mysql by using mysql connectorj, mysql abs jdbc driver for mysql. In this example we are using mysql as the database. Mysql connectorj is the official jdbc driver for mysql. Unless you are extremely good hibernate will be better at translation than any custom made solution. In general, applicationspecific jars such as hibernate s connection pooling jars should not be placed in the lib directory of tomcat. What i want to do hear is just do a very simple test to make sure that our jdbc connection works just fine.

If you cannot find a name of a database vendor in the list of data sources, download a jdbc driver for the database management system dbms, and create a connection in intellij idea. How to connect xampp mysql database with jdbc netbeans project. But it is important to learn basics and it requires learning jdbc first. Create a connection to a database with a jdbc driver. Unable to open jdbc connection for schema management target f. We suggest that you use the md5 checksums and gnupg signatures to verify the integrity of the packages you download.

How to connect mysql database in java jdbc connection edureka. Once glassfish is installed, make sure it can access mysql connectorj. Also you should always close the database connection once you complete. Unless otherwise noted, properties can be set for a datasource object or for a connection object. So if a connection has been idle longer than this timeout value, it will be dropped by the server. Hibernate must peacefully coexist in various deployment environments, from application servers to standalone applications. Even if using jdbc, you will end up making some translation layer, so that you transfer your data to your objects. To run it with java command, we need to load the mysql jdbc driver manually. In previous versions of jdbc, to obtain a connection, you first had to initialize your jdbc driver by calling the method class. If there is a database system that i forgot to add, add a comment and ill update the article. Jdbc is one of the standard java api for databaseindependent connectivity between the java programming language and a wide range of databases. With mysql connectorj, the name of this class is com. If port is not specified, the corresponding default is used. When you create a new project that uses the hibernate framework, the ide automatically creates the g.

In this post, we will see how to connect java application with mysql database. These java apis enables java programs to execute sql statements and interact with any sql compliant database. This tutorial shows how to add jdbc driver to eclipse which is used by eclipse when you add database connections through eclipse. Mar 20, 2020 this allows you to have mariadb connectorj and mysql s jdbc driver in your classpath at the same time. In this tutorial, we will show you how to download postgresql jdbc driver, and connect to the postgresql database server from a java program. How to code a basic java hibernate program using eclipse. By default, hibernate uses its internal database connection pool library. The template may actually work for other database as well by changing the values within the tags. With the jdbc driver, you can connect to dbms and start working. Jdbc stands for java database connectivity, which is a standard java api for databaseindependent connectivity between the java programming language and a wide range of databases. This section explains how to use mysql connectorj with glassfish server open source edition 3. This mainly involves opening a connection, creating a sql database, executing sql queries and then arriving.

Net enabling developers to build database applications in their language of choice. Open the plugins manager and install the sakila sample database plugin. Connecting to mysql using jdbc driver mysql tutorial. Building highperformance web applications in mysql 2006 by guy harrison, steven feuerstein mysql crash course 2005 by ben forta a guide to mysql available titles skills assessment manager sam office 2010 2005 by philip j. Platform independent architecture independent, zip archive. Hibernate is a javabased framework that aims at relieving developers from common database programming tasks such as writing sql queries manually with jdbc. That means it keeps a database connection open to be reused later. Configuration properties define how connectorj will make a connection to a mysql server. Which url, jdbc driver and hibernate dialect i have to use. You can obtain the latest distribution of hibernate framework at. Mysql connectorj is a jdbc type 4 driver, implementing the jdbc 4. So we need to know following informations for the mysql database.

You will have to make sure that you have testdb database available in your mysql database and you have a user test available to access the database. I have never used hibernate mapping wizard but as far as i know this is useful to create a hibernate mapping file with an extension. Search and download functionalities are using the official maven repository. Each jdbc driver contains one or more classes that implements the interface java.

This api lets you encode the access request statements, in structured query language sql. Jboss and mysql connector content archive read only. You will be taken to the jdbc connection pools page where all current connection pools, including the one you just created, will be displayed in the jdbc connection pools frame click on the connection pool you just created. Knowing the jdbc driver connection url strings is mandatory if you want to connect to a relational database system from a java application. Have basic knowledge of xml for the configuration file and mapping documents. Perform sql operations this tutorial show you how to use netbeans to connect mysql by using mysql connectorj, mysql abs jdbc driver for. Intermittent connection to mysql db from java programs. With this method, you could use an external configuration file to supply the driver class name and driver parameters to use when connecting to a database. The only difference will be connection url and the database dialect to be specified in the configuration file. In the appeared new driver definition dialog, select the mysql in the vendor filter combo box and select the latest mysql jdbc driver from the listed drivers. Jsf database example, jsf mysql example, jsf jdbc connection example, jsf application to display data from database example code, download project code. Crud with java, hibernate and mysql part 1 amrut medium.

In this tutorial, you will learn how to delete data from a table in the postgresql database using jdbc. Apr 01, 2017 download source code for hibernate tutorial. In this article, we will build a simple login form using jsp, jdbc and mysql database. Jul 17, 2019 by default, hibernate uses its internal database connection pool library. Create a connection accessing mysql on netbeans using jdbc, part 2. Same steps can be followed to add any other jdbc drivers to eclipse.

Configuring mysql database with hibernate is the same as with other databasses. Hibernate also requires a set of configuration settings related to database and other. Based on the above, the mysql connection jar will need to be placed in the webinflib directory.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. In this example, we will write jdbc code separate from the jsp. In this post, i am giving an example of making a connection with database using mysql driver. Therefore, when you create a connection object, you should always put it inside a try catch block. Singlehost connections adding hostspecific properties. Mysql is one of the most popular opensource database systems available today. Download mysql connectorjava jar file with dependencies documentation source code all downloads are free.

74 775 957 1064 509 1292 1495 1302 408 608 1232 985 1373 514 1370 960 751 391 526 565 1231 178 28 257 296 1030 540 576 391 149 478 345 373 292 1331 966 594 1336 1205 925 270 838 734 473 451